WebFebruary 2014 I have always gotten a blister on the bottom of my pinky toe when I walk a lot - we're talking vacation/sightseeing type walking, where you're walking for hours at a … WebSTEP 1: TAKE A LOOK AT THE ROOF OF YOUR HEEL BLISTER AND TREAT IT ACCORDINGLY. Is the roof of your toe blister: Intact – Put an island dressing on it. Torn – Apply some antiseptic/antibiotic and cover it with an island dressing. Deroofed – Apply some antiseptic/antibiotic and apply either an island dressing, or a hydrocolloid bandage.

WebTo prevent a stubbed toe, wear proper shoes and avoid walking or running barefoot. How common is a stubbed toe? Stubbed toes are extremely common. Nearly everyone stubs their toe from time to time. Most often, this injury affects your big toe or your pinky toe (your little toe). But you can stub any toe on your foot. WebFeb 28, 2024 · Getting Black Toenails From Running or Walking. At the end of a long walk or run, you may notice that a toenail has turned black, blue, or gray, and your toe may be swollen under the nail. You are getting a black toenail due to bleeding under your nail, which is also known as a subungual hematoma. This can also happen if you drop something on ...

WebJan 23, 2024 · A friction blister is a soft pocket of raised skin filled with clear fluid caused by irritation from continuous rubbing or pressure. Friction blisters usually occur on the feet, where tight or poor-fitting shoes can rub and irritate delicate toes and heels for long periods of time. Cotton socks may feel soft and comfy, but they may also be the perfect breeding ground for blisters on your feet. “One-hundred percent cotton socks are not the ... grandmother josephine mandaminWebFeb 25, 2024 · Swab the blister with iodine. Clean a sharp needle with rubbing alcohol. Use the needle to prick the blister in several spots near the edge. Let the fluid drain, but leave the overlying skin in place. Apply an ointment such as petroleum jelly to the blister and cover it with a nonstick gauze bandage.
